Jacobs Aquatic Center in Key Largo, Florida
Jacobs Aquatic Center is a 3-pool complex located in Key Largo, Florida Keys featuring:
- A 25-meter 8-lane MYRTHA competition pool (5-7' deep) with Colorado timing system and modern LED scoreboard, and a contiguous diving pool (12' 3" deep) with one 3-meter and two 1-meter diving boards. The pool and diving well are suitable for SCUBA certification, synchronized swimming, and water polo.
- A 24'x44' ramp-accessible multipurpose MYRTHA pool (3-4' deep) for swim classes, water aerobics, water exercise, and recreation.
- An interactive play pool/water park (12-18" deep) featuring a Pirate Ship, spray gym, and "beachfront" entry.


Programming offered includes:
- Youth Swim Team
- Swim Lessons
- Water Aerobics
- American Red Cross Lifeguard Training
- Summer Camp
This facility is available for Team Training and is conveniently located within short walking distance from major hotels.
